Jiading district is located in the northwestern part of Shanghai, covering an area of 463 square kilometers.

The district includes seven towns (Anting, Malu, Nanxiang, Jiangqiao, Xuhang, Waigang, and Huating) and three sub-districts (Jiadingzhen, Xincheng Rd, and Zhenxin). It also encompasses the Jiading Industrial Zone and Juyuan New Area.

Jiading benefits from its strategic position as a key hub connecting Shanghai to the Yangtze River Delta, bolstered by the development of the Hongqiao International Opening-up Hub and the advancement of Jiading New City.

The district is home to a robust economy, with continuous improvements made in key economic indicators. In 2024, Jiading achieved a total industrial output value of 469.43 billion yuan ($65.46 billion). Foreign trade is thriving, with a total import and export value of 173.89 billion yuan from January to November 2024, marking a 13.8 percent increase from the previous year. Contracted foreign investment surged by 104.9 percent to $1.83 billion.

Jiading is home to Shanghai International Automobile City, fostering a world-class auto industry cluster that integrates manufacturing, education, and services.

Emerging industries are also thriving in Jiading, particularly in strategic sectors like new energy vehicles, the Internet of Things (IoT), and biomedicine. The district offers substantial policy support for businesses, providing financial incentives for the headquarters economy, public listings, and innovation projects, with significant funds available for healthcare equipment, precision medicine, and IoT initiatives.

The district hosts 11 national research institutes and several centers affiliated with the Chinese Academy of Sciences.

Jiading boasts excellent transportation links, being a short drive from both Pudong and Hongqiao International Airports. Major railways and highways traverse Jiading, including the Shanghai-Nanjing Railway and Beijing-Shanghai High-Speed Railway, as well as several expressways and metro lines.

Rich in historical and cultural heritage, Jiading hosts festivals like the Confucius Culture Festival and promotes traditional arts such as bamboo carving. It is home to numerous scenic spots, including the Fahua Pagoda and Qiuxia Garden. The Shanghai International Circuit in the district is the venue for international events like the F1 World Championship Chinese Grand Prix.
